No. Polk was here 2 years and took us to a CWS in 2001. Since then we made 3 other CWS including being one game away from a national title in 2008 and have made 6 tournament appearances, the last once coming in 2011.

Shot went south for this program when both Chance Veazey and Jonathan Taylor found themselves paralyzed due to separate freak accidents. Conpletely killed Pernos drive to recruit and develop which eventually led to his dismissal. Problem from there is we had to rely on McGarity to make a quality hire for who "quality" means "value" so we got Scott Stricklin on the cheap from a mid major he small balled to a CWS, the complete opposite of Pernos power hitting teams with guys like Beckham, Poythress, Keppinger, Lewis, etc
